- Niyyah for the namaaz/roza is in the heart only. It is not said verbally.

- A du'aa (contains du'aa/dhikr for morning & evening, after namaaz etc) book in farsi is available to download here:

https://islamhouse.com/fa/books/647


- Du'aa said after breaking the fast:



ذَهَبَ الظَّمَأُ وَابْتَلَّتْ الْعُرُوقُ وَثَبَتَ الأَجْرُ إِنْ شَاءَ اللَّهُ (تشنگی رفت و رگ-ها تر شد و ان شاءالله پاداش آن تثبیت شد) [به روایت ابوداود. آلبانی در صحیح سنن ابی-داود (۲۰۶۶) آن را حسن دانسته است]
